Camera! Lights! Action! It’s time to enjoy a free movie under
the starry summer sky. Spend your Fridays in July on Art Hill with the Saint Louis Art Museum’s Outdoor Film Series. The party starts at 7 p.m. with food, music and festivities on Art Hill Plaza. A Monty Python, Hitchcock, Beatles or Bond movie will give you a much needed blast from the past.
Saint Louis Art Museum’s Outdoor Film Series • July 6, 13, 20, 27 • 7 p.m. • Free • Art Hill in Forest Park
• Join Miss Piggy, Kermit the Frog, Fozzie the Bear and the rest of the gang for a free movie in the park. The City of St. Peters will show four free movies this summer at four different parks in St. Charles County. Films include The Muppets, Hugo and the Adventures of Tintin. On October 5, you’re invited on a journey of a lifetime during The Wizard of Oz sing-along. Dress up as your favorite character, hiss at the Wicked Witch and sing your heart out to one of the most beloved films of all times.
St. Peter’s Movies in the Park • July 6, September 7 and October 5 • Free • Various locations
• St. Charles Community College is not only home to higher learning, it’s also a great place to catch The Lorax, The Goonies or The Wizard of Oz this summer. "We've had such great attendance at our movie nights in the past, that we wanted to offer programming over the summer, too,” said Mandi Smith, SCC student activities coordinator. “It’s a fun event for the whole family to attend.”
Outdoor Summer Movie Series at St. Charles Community College • June 15, July 20 and August 10 • 8 p.m. • Free • On the lawn outside the Technology Building at St. Charles Community College
• Wishing you could have seen Rio or The Smurfs on the big screen? Thanks to Wehrenberg Theatres Family Summer Series 2012, you still can. For ten Wednesday and Thursday mornings this summer, your family can catch a free showing of a recently released, kid-friendly flick like Hop, Mr. Popper’s Penguins, Winnie the Pooh or Zookeeper. Seating is on a first-come, first served basis, so arrive early to get your spot.
Wehrenberg Theatres Family Summer Series 2012 • Wednesday and Thursdays June 6 to August 16 • 10 a.m. • Free • Local Wehrenberg Theatres
• The City of Chesterfield shows off its new Amphitheater by inviting families to enjoy free movies, starting July 7 with Happy Feet. There is a combination of fixed and lawn seating, so bring blankets or lawn chairs and enjoy the stars (and the concession stand).
Free Movies at the Chesterfield Amphitheater • July 13, Aug. 10 • Veteran's Place Drive in Chesterfield
• Later this summer, Wildwood kicks off its movies nights will Wildwood Movies on the Plaza. Enjoy family favorites like Toy Story 3, Shark Tale and Transformers. The city provides popcorn, beverages and the movie all free of charge.
Wildwood Movie Nights on the Plaza • August 10, Sept. 14, Oct. 5 • Town Center Plaza just west of City Hall
